The annual salary statistics of general internal medicine physicians in McAllen-Edinburg-Mission, Texas is shown in Table 1. The wage data of general internal medicine physicians in McAllen-Edinburg-Mission is based on the national compensation survey conducted by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ics in 2022 and published in April 2023 [1].
Percentile Bracket | Average Annual Salary |
---|---|
10th Percentile Wage | $142,810 |
25th Percentile Wage | $169,420 |
50th Percentile Wage | $169,420 |
75th Percentile Wage | $169,420 |
90th Percentile Wage | No Data |
Table 1 shows the average annual salary for general internal medicine physicians in McAllen-Edinburg-Mission, Texas in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 75th percentile (the top 25 percent of the highest paid) is $169,420. The median (50th percentile) annual salary is $169,420.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ent earners is $142,810.
